For at least 5,000 years, human beings have been crushing grapes and allowing them to ferment naturally into wine. Regrettably in recent times, as with other farm products, chemical fertilizers, pesticides, herbicides, fungicides and other synthetic chemicals have been used on vineyards. The chemicals were intended to make life easier for the farmer and increase production.
However, time has shown the devastating effects of these chemicals on the planet. By supplying organically grown grapes to Greener Planet, each grower is bringing balance back to their vineyards. The growers do not use any synthetic chemicals on their vineyards, instead utilize compost, cover crops, farm animals, and natural minerals to protect and nourish the vineyards. To guarantee their commitment, each grower has been certified organic by ECOCERT, a world leader in organic certification and is accredited for National Organic Program (NOP) certification.
By utilizing natural procedures in the vineyards, the grapes reflect a more pure varietal character and a more true expression of terroir, the way nature intended. Traditional techniques of hand pruning assist the organic farming to ensure the grapes fully express the varietal character and the notion of terroir, sense of place. Hand pruning permits the growers to fine tune the vineyard by trimming the weaker shoots, leaves and unripe grape bunches. At harvest time, each grower selects the best bunches, yielding a more uniform ripeness and a higher quality.
The winemakers for Greener Planet utilize simple vinification techniques to maintain the integrity of the organically grown grapes. Some of the techniques used during the vinification process are racking, transfer wine from one container to another once the sediment has settled, and filtering through organic filters by a gravity fed system. These simple techniques plus the high quality of the grapes reduces the need for sulfites, which are kept below the authorized limits, yet a little is necessary to maintain the quality and prevent bacterial growth.

Greener Planet - Wine into Water
Greener Planet believes one of the world’s biggest problems is a chronic shortage of water. Over a billion people do not have access to clean drinking water, which is why Greener Planet has started the Wine into Water project. For every bottle sold, Greener Planet will make a contribution to Water Aid; a non-profit organization dedicated exclusively to the provision of safe drinking water, sanitation, and hygiene education for the world’s
poorest people. Greener Planet will not produce any wine in areas afflicted with chronic water shortages.
Since 2006, Greener Planet has donated over $20,000 to Water Aid projects in India and Burkina Faso in West Africa. Over a billion people do not have access to clean drinking water, and an estimated 5 million people die from preventable water-related diseases each year.
